WebFeb 10, 2024 · In Italian, there are two main ways you can translate the word now.One is ora and the second is adesso.. IPA: /ˈo.ra/ IPA: /aˈdɛs.so/ For all intents and purposes, ora and adesso are synonyms in modern day Italian, and swapping one for the other will rarely sound strange to the native ear.Ora derives from the Latin hora (“hour”) whereas adesso … WebDid you know that “vespa” means “wasp” in Italian? 7:00 – 8:00 am. WebDec 20, 2015 · Days of the week in italian. Days of the week in italian are : I giorni (singolare = giorno) della settimana sono : Lunedì – Monday. Martedì – Tuesday. Mercoledì – Wednesday. Giovedì – Thursday. Venerdì – Friday. Sabato – Saturday. WebHow to pronounce the days of the week in Italian. Here are the days of the week.... Lunedì - Monday. Martedì - Tuesday. Mercoledì - Wednesday. Giovedì - Thursday. Venerdì - Friday. Sabato - Saturday. Domenica - Sunday.
